No increase in green bin charge in Wiltshire

For the third year running the cost is staying the same

Author: Henrietta CreaseyPublished 12th May 2021

Households in Wiltshire that pay to receive garden waste collections will soon receive an email or letter inviting them to renew their subscription by 30th June.

There's good news for green fingered fans as the cost of the service remains the same at ÂŁ50 per bin for the year!

New customers can sign up at any time to receive garden waste collections, either online at Wiltshire.gov.uk/gardenwaste or by calling 0300 456 0103.

From April 2020 to March this year more than 30,000 tonnes of garden waste was collected from over 82,000 households in Wiltshire.

Sam Fox, Director for Place said,

"All of the garden waste collected in Wiltshire is composted locally, which helps reduce pollution and also diverts waste from landfill."

Sam also has a plea when it comes to paying for your bin;

"We are asking people not to pay by cheque unless absolutely necessary, as processing cheque payments will take longer because of the extra precautions that have been put in place to reduce the spread of Covid-19.

"However, most garden waste customers already pay online as this is the quickest and easiest way to pay. We are asking people to renew online if at all possible, to minimise the number of phone calls we receive and help keep our phonelines open for vulnerable residents trying to contact us."

Once people have renewed their subscription, they will be sent a letter within three weeks, containing a new garden waste bin sticker.

Garden waste bins are emptied fortnightly except for two weeks over Christmas and New Year.

WHAT CAN GO IN A GREEN BIN?

You can throw in the following;

  • Bark,
  • grass cuttings,
  • cut flowers,
  • leaves,
  • weeds,
  • hedge clippings,
  • twigs and small branches

Whilst it's a big NO for:

  • Fruit and vegetable peelings,
  • food waste, cardboard,
  • paper,
  • soil and rubble
  • pet litter and animal waste.
